Key Drivers Supporting Growth in the Smart Fleet Management Market
One of the main forces propelling the smart fleet management market is the growing demand for autonomous fleet operations. Companies are continuously seeking ways to improve efficiency, safety, and reduce operational expenses, which autonomous technologies help achieve by automating routine tasks and optimizing fleet utilization.
Additionally, intensified investments in connected vehicle infrastructure are paving the way for better communication between vehicles and control centers. This interconnectedness enables smoother data exchange and improves decision-making through real-time insights, thereby supporting smarter fleet management practices.

A notable development occurred in September 2024 when Powerfleet, Inc., a US-based AIoT and connected asset management company, acquired Fleet Complete for approximately $200 million. This strategic move strengthens Powerfleet's portfolio by combining Fleet Complete's smart fleet management solutions with its own capabilities in real-time vehicle tracking, IoT-enabled asset monitoring, and mobile workforce management. Fleet Complete, headquartered in Canada, is recognized for delivering comprehensive connected fleet services.

Emerging Technological Trends Shaping the Smart Fleet Management Market
Innovation remains a central focus for companies within the smart fleet management space, especially in developing two-way communication systems that enable real-time diagnostics and machine status updates. Two-way communication facilitates a dynamic exchange of information, allowing both sides to send and receive data for improved feedback and operational control.
For example, in February 2024, JLG Industries, Inc., a US machinery manufacturer, introduced ClearSky Smart Fleet. This solution represents a shift from traditional one-way telematics to a fully interactive IoT platform that offers advanced machine interactivity. ClearSky enhances operational efficiency through digital workflows, precise equipment tracking, and expanded service functionalities. The platform also uses automated networks to streamline logistics and delivers actionable real-time insights for better fleet performance.
